David W. Kimberlin is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Infectious Diseases and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health. According to data from OpenAlex, David W. Kimberlin has authored 137 papers receiving a total of 6.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 114 papers in Epidemiology, 44 papers in Infectious Diseases and 17 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health. Recurrent topics in David W. Kimberlin’s work include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(66 papers), Cytomegalovirus and herpesvirus research (60 papers) and Parvovirus B19 Infection Studies (25 papers). David W. Kimberlin is often cited by papers focused on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(66 papers), Cytomegalovirus and herpesvirus research (60 papers) and Parvovirus B19 Infection Studies (25 papers). David W. Kimberlin coll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Italy. David W. Kimberlin's co-authors include Richard J. Whitley, Bernard Roizman, Scott H. James, Swetha Pinninti, Richard F. Jacobs, Pablo J. Sánchez, Mark Shelton, Concetta Marsico, Gail J. Demmler and Robert F. Pass and has published in prestigious journals such as New England Journal of Medicine, PEDIATRICS and Clinical Microbiology Reviews.
